Perks Matriculation Higher Secondary School, India, is a part of Perks Institutions that is run by the Ramaswami Naidu and Ramaranganathan charities, Coimbatore. The school was founded by Mr. R. Rama Ranganathan in the year 1971. The school is situated in the heart of the Coimbatore City.

Nirmala Matha Convent Higher Secondary School (formerly Nirmala Matha Convent Matriculation Higher Secondary School) is a higher secondary school in Kuniyamuthur and Vellalore, in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u, India. It was founded in 1993 by Sisters of the Adoration of the Blessed Sacrament [S.A.B.S.]. [2] [3] The school follows state board syllabus.
